WebThe Complaints Tracking Module (CTM) is a module within the Health Plan Management System (HPMS). It is the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services’ (CMS) central repository for complaints received from various CMS sources, including, but not limited to, 1-800-Medicare call centers and regional WebFeb 17, 2024 · Introducción. WebDescription: DSS Consult Tracking Manager (CTM) is a web-based software solution that provides an instant, up to date dashboard view of the status of all patient consults in a clinical environment. Consult Tracking Manager is a server-based software that integrates with clinical data within the Veterans Health Information Systems and Technology ...
